What state has the highest suicide rate in the United States? This is a question that has sparked concern and debate among policymakers, mental health professionals, and the general public. The state with the highest suicide rate is often a subject of discussion, as it highlights the need for effective mental health care and support systems.

The state with the highest suicide rate can vary from year to year, but some states consistently rank at the top. According to recent statistics, states like Alaska, Montana, and Wyoming have consistently reported higher suicide rates compared to others. These states often face unique challenges, such as remote locations, high rates of poverty, and limited access to mental health resources.

Several factors contribute to the higher suicide rates in these states. One significant factor is the presence of rural populations, which often face isolation and limited access to mental health services. Additionally, economic challenges, such as high unemployment rates and low income levels, can exacerbate mental health issues and increase the risk of suicide.

Another contributing factor is the prevalence of substance abuse, particularly alcohol and drug addiction. Substance abuse can lead to severe mental health problems, such as depression and anxiety, which are significant risk factors for suicide. Unfortunately, many individuals in these states struggle to access treatment for substance abuse and mental health issues.

To address the issue of high suicide rates, states with the highest rates have been implementing various strategies. One approach is to increase funding for mental health services and expand access to treatment programs. This includes investing in community-based programs, mobile crisis teams, and telepsychiatry services to reach individuals in remote areas.

Furthermore, states have been working to raise awareness about mental health issues and reduce the stigma associated with seeking help. Campaigns aimed at promoting mental health awareness and encouraging individuals to seek support have shown promising results in some states.

Despite these efforts, the challenge of reducing suicide rates remains significant. Mental health professionals argue that a comprehensive approach is needed, involving not only increased access to treatment but also addressing the underlying social determinants of health, such as poverty, unemployment, and substance abuse.
